#4b6ff3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b6ff3 is composed of 29.4% red, 43.5%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.5% and a lightness of 62.4%. #4b6ff3 color hex could be obtained by blending #96deff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4b6ff3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b6ff3 has RGB values of R:75, G:111,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4943859.

Shades and Tints of #4b6ff3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b6ff3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9da2 is the less saturated color, while #446bfa is the most saturated one.
